The Overconfidence Cycle: Pride → Conviction → Confirmation & Desirability Biases → Validation → More Pride The Rethinking Cycle: Humility → Doubt → Curiosity → Discovery → Deeper Humility These contrasting cycles highlight the difference between being stuck in our certainties and embracing the power of open-mindedness. While overconfidence might feel good temporarily, rethinking and questioning can lead to true growth and wisdom. Emotional intelligence is about creating space between stimulus and reaction, allowing us to respond thoughtfully. As Viktor Frankl (via Stephen Covey) said, “Between stimulus and response there is a space. In that space is our power to choose our response. In our response lies our growth and our freedom.” By observing how our thoughts, feelings, and actions are interconnected, we can improve our emotional intelligence and achieve better results. Start by simply noticing your reactions to create the space to respond instead. #EmotionalIntelligence #PersonalGrowth #Leadership
